Transaction 79b3a34e8821673595cef643bb881096ed09efc832c6147fa4e7a056a83d1425
1 Input
1 Output
-
79b3a34e8821673595cef643bb881096ed09efc832c6147fa4e7a056a83d1425:0
- value
- 31172409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77997d6d907c143787099a3b2b448e4c9a615869 OP_EQUAL
- address
- 3CbQD3JRFksaW2hs3WiLRhxUsJ6abc2gzn